Fairfield and Ottumwa named joint hosts for the 2015 Iowa Tourism Conference

Fairfield Convention and Visitors Bureau

Fairfield, (Iowa) – In a unique collaboration, two southern Iowa communities recently bid for the chance to host the Iowa Tourism Conference. The unlikely duo not only submitted a strong proposal but defeated Des Moines for the opportunity to hold the event. Those two communities are none other than Ottumwa and Fairfield. The Ottumwa...

Kirksville Storm Debris Clean-Up Information

kirksville2

KIRKSVILLE STORM DEBRIS CLEAN-UP INFORMATION (Kirksville, MO) –The City of Kirksville will assist citizens by providing curbside pickup for limbs and brush from the recent storms. Citizens of Kirksville with property impacted by this storm are encouraged to contact their insurance provider prior to beginning any major clean-up efforts on damaged property. Once ready...
